Tigers ends season with loss to Mules

Leilehua 35, McKinley 20: At Leilehua, Cheyne Todani threw three touchdown passes to help the Mules (3-4-1) turn back the Tigers (2-6).   The Tigers season came to a close Friday night.  Widereceiver Rene Melson was bothered by  knee injury   from a screen from Pavich, but nevertheless caught 5 passes for 87 yards and a TD.   The Star of the game was Kenoche Mostella who had 147 combined rushing and receiving yards.  Mostella came up big on a dive play, a screen and a reverse.   Pavich passed for 226, but also had 3 passes picked off, one for a touchdown.   The Tigers will now look down to the White Conference next year.  Along with the Tigers moving down are Castle, Campbell.

McKinley	6 0  0  14 - 20
Leilehua	14 0 14  7 - 35

 

LEI - Joshua Tomas 6 pass from Cheyne Todani (Kurt Uchiyama kick)
McK - Augustine Nepo 20 pass from Abraham Pavich (run failed)
LEI - Tomas 22 pass from Todani (Uchiyama kick)
LEI - Bronson Dumlao 49 interception return (Uchiyama kick)
LEI - Brandon Furtado 39 pas from Todani (Uchiyama kick)
McK - Rene Melson 20 pass from Pavich (Kenoche Mostella run)
McK - K. Mostella 12 pass from Pavich (run failed)
LEI - Kendall Stringfield 15 run (Uchiyama kick)

Rushing - McKinley: Pavich 2-8, Sam Faili 2-9, Nepo 1-(-6), Mostella 3-73, Vaa Fonoti 2-9. Leilehua: Darius Boulton 10-26, Todani 2-14, Stringfield 10-59, Dumlao 4-7.

Passing - McKinley: Pavich 16-36-3 for 226 yards, Kaipo Avilez 1-4-0 for 36 yards. Leilehua: Todani 10-30-1 for 189 yards.

Receiving - McKinley: Melson 5-87, Edsley Hicks 4-51, Nepo 3-31, Pavich 1-10, Mostella 4-74. Leilehua: Brandon Rickard 2-28, Tomas 4-50, Furtado 3-58, Uchiyama 1-17.

Junior varsity - McKinley 24, Leilehua 9.
